|  seatpost length | DC Steve Jan 19, 2004 7:09 PM | | with a 35" inseam, i've been riding an 18.75" hardtail with my seatpost sitting about 28cm out of the seat tube...
what would i lose if i went up in size on my bike to 20", and what could I gain, assuming toptube remains the same (obviously angles drop some) |
|  re: seatpost length | laffeaux Jan 19, 2004 7:34 PM | | If the top tube stays exactly the same, and the seat tube is lengthened, the important angles (head tube and seat tube) could easily stay exactly the same (there's no reason that they'd have to change), and the only changes to the bike would be:
- less standover
- the handlebars might be higher if a taller head tube was used |
